Analog Devices Inc. ADSPSC835W-EV-SOM System-on-Module (SOM) Board

Analog Devices ADSPSC835W-EV-SOM System-on-Module (SOM) Board allows for rapid prototyping of designs featuring the ADSP-SC83x/2183x series (ADSP-SC834/ADSP-SC835/ADSP-21836/ADSP-21837) of SHARC-FX audio processors. The board employs an easy-to-use plug-n-play reference design with expansion capabilities to interface to custom hardware ahead of the processor's release.

When the ADI ADSP21835-EV-SOM board is connected to the EV-SOMCRR-EZKIT or EV-SOMCRR-EZLITE carrier board, the resulting EZ-KIT® evaluation system can quickly and easily evaluate the processor core and system peripherals/interfaces.

The ADSP21835-EV-SOM allows rapid prototyping for a wide range of applications, including immersive 3D sound and personal audio zones (PAZ), automotive active and road noise cancellation (ANC/RNC), voice-based user interfaces and in-car communications (ICC), engine sound synthesis (ESS) and electric vehicle warning sound systems (EVWSS/AVAS). Additional applications include professional audio and soundbars/home AVRs (with 3D Object and Multi-Channel Audio) and enhanced conferencing systems.

The ADSP21835-EV-SOM module implements the CrossCore® Embedded Studio (CCES) development tools to facilitate developers to achieve faster market time.
